jQuery Ajax通用js封装 第一步:引入jQuery库 第二步:开发Ajax封装类,已测试通过,可以直接调用,直接贴代码,讲解就省了 第三步:调用模拟 ...
在各种前端框架如React VUE Angular等层出不穷的今天,前端的开发效率大大提高,且前端在用原始技术开发时的许多问题在使用了框架后也不存在了,个人在使用了vue开发项目后,觉得这些框架真的太好了,真的给我们节省了很多的开发时间。话虽如此,但依然有很多的前端小伙伴在使用基于jquery的前端技术,也包括本人。 那么问题来了,前端在开发时势必会调后端的接口,就会用到ajax,就会在调接口时可 ...
2016-08-05 17:28 5 17001 推荐指数:
jQuery Ajax通用js封装 第一步:引入jQuery库 第二步:开发Ajax封装类,已测试通过,可以直接调用,直接贴代码,讲解就省了 第三步:调用模拟 ...
虽然jquery的较新的api已经很好用了, 但是在实际工作还是有做二次封装的必要,好处有:1,二次封装后的API更加简洁,更符合个人的使用习惯;2,可以对ajax操作做一些统一处理,比如追加随机数或其它参数。同时在工作中,我们还会发现,有一些ajax请求的数据,对实时性要求不高,即使我们把第一次 ...
AJAX 异步的JavaScript与XML技术( Asynchronous JavaScript and XML ) Ajax 核心使用 `XMLHttpRequest` (XHR)对象,首先由微软引入的一个特性;Ajax 不需要任何浏览器插件 ...
当然了 我封装的是$.ajax 可以传参数 多次调用请求接口 为啥我们这地方不注重前端呢 我都不知道为啥去坚持 不说了 上代码 js文件 $ajax.js $(function(){ /** * ajax封装 * url 发送请求的地址 * data 发送到服务器 ...
主要做3点: 1、配置一个请求地址前缀 2、请求拦截(在请求发出去之前拦截),给所有的请求都带上 token 3、拦截响应,遇到 token 不合法则报错 ...
vue对组件进行二次封装 经常遇到常用组件与设计图有微小区别的情况,但是自写组件功能又太单一(划掉 其实原因就是懒),这个时候对组件封装就很有用处 例如对 element 的 MessageBox 二次封装 组件有很多自定义内容 例如 MessageBox 可自定义配置不同内容 ...
对MBProgressHUD进行二次封装并精简使用 https://github.com/jdg/MBProgressHUD 几个效果图: 以下源码是MBProgressHUD支持最新的iOS8的版本,没有任何的警告信息 MBProgressHUD.h ...
项目中对axios进行二次封装 随着前端技术的发展,网络请求这一块,越来越多的程序猿选择使用axios来实现网络请求。但是单纯的axios插件并不能满足我们日常的使用,因此我们使用时,需要根据项目实际的情况来对axios进行二次封装。 接下来就我对axios的二次封装详细的说说,主要包括 ...